Message type: E = Error
Message class: SB - Version Management Messages
Message number: 147
Message text: Choose no more than two objects

- Choose no more than two objects ?The SAP error message SB147 ("Choose no more than two objects") typically occurs in the context of certain transactions or reports where the system restricts the selection of objects to a maximum of two. This is often seen in scenarios involving the selection of multiple items for processing, such as in the case of transport requests, object comparisons, or similar functionalities.
Cause:
The error is triggered when a user attempts to select more than two objects in a transaction or report that has a predefined limit on the number of selectable items. This limitation is often in place to ensure system performance, data integrity, or to comply with specific business rules.
Solution:
To resolve the SB147 error, you should:
Reduce the Selection: Go back to the selection screen and ensure that you are only selecting a maximum of two objects. Deselect any additional objects that you may have inadvertently selected.
Review Documentation: Check the documentation or help text associated with the transaction to understand the limitations and the rationale behind them.
Consult with SAP Support: If you believe that the limitation is hindering your work and you need to select more than two objects,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ting SAP notes for potential workarounds or updates.
